You can enroll in a Medicare Advantage plan if you’re first eligible for Medicare, or through the annual Medicare open enrollment period in the fall . If you’re enrolled in each Medicare Part A and Part B , you’re eligible to enroll in a Medigap plan to supplement your Medicare coverage. You’ll have a six-month guaranteed-problem window throughout which you can join any Medigap plan out there in your space. In most states and most circumstances, you’ll need to undergo medical underwriting should you determine to use for a Medigap plan after that window ends. You can delay your Part B effective date as much as three months if you enroll when you nonetheless have employer-sponsored coverage or inside one month after that coverage ends. Otherwise, your Part B coverage will begin the month after you enroll. The Part B SEP allows beneficiaries to delay enrollment if they have health coverage through their own or a spouse’s current employer.

If you qualify, you'll be able to return to Original Medicare or join, change or drop a Medicare Advantage or Medicare prescription drug plan. If you choose to go back to Original Medicare on this qualifying occasion, you may also apply for a Medicare Supplement plan. There are many types of qualifying occasions, including transferring into or out of a care facility, or moving out of your present plan’s service area. Some states could have extra open enrollment periods, and there could also be different conditions by which your acceptance could also be guaranteed.

If you could have missed the Fall Medicare Open Enrollment period, there is a Medicare Advantage Open Enrollment Period, which lasts from January 1 to March 31 yearly. During this other Medicare Open Enrollment interval, you can change from one Medicare Advantage plan to another, and you could go back to Original Medicare. If you come to Part A and Part B coverage, you'll be able to usually enroll in a stand-alone Medicare Part D Prescription Drug Plan. Keep in mind that this Medicare Open Enrollment period is only for beneficiaries enrolled in Medicare Advantage plans.

The bids are in comparison with the pre-determined benchmark quantities set, that are the maximum amount Medicare will pay a plan in a given county. If a plan's bid is higher than the benchmark, enrollees pay the distinction between the benchmark and the bid within the type of a monthly premium, in addition to the Medicare Part B premium.
